Bee-ginner’s Beekeeping: Basics of Apiculture Course

March 8, 2022

Mon., Mar. 7, Bee-ginner’s Beekeeping: Basics of Apiculture Course, Rutgers’ Online Beekeeping Courses. Learn how to start, maintain, and care for a honey bee colony in this introductory online, self-paced course. Topics include bee biology, disease and mite prevention, hive assembly and management, honey extraction, queen bee purchasing, and more. The cost is $275-$300. Click here to register.
